Back to Search
Senior PySpark Developer
Sorry, this position is no longer available
We are seeking a highly skilled remote Senior PySpark Developer to join our team.
The ideal candidate must have extensive experience in Data Science and possess strong technical skills in DSE Snowflake, AWS, and Spark. Additionally, excellent English communication skills and familiarity with Apache Kafka, Docker, and Kubernetes are desirable.
Responsibilities
- Develop PySpark ETL pipelines and configure Kafka connectors
- Build and maintain the Jenkins pipeline for schedulers, CI/CD, etc.
- Collaborate with the development team to ensure seamless integration with other systems
- Ensure high-quality code through the use of code review tools such as Sonar
- Effectively communicate status and issues to project stakeholders
Requirements
- At least 3 years of experience as a PySpark Developer
- Strong expertise in Data Science and proficiency in Snowflake, AWS, and Spark
- Familiarity with Apache Kafka, Docker, and Kubernetes
- Expertise in PyCharm as the recommended IDE
- B2+ English level
Nice to have
- Familiarity with SQL
- Experience with Atlassian tools (Bitbucket, Jira, Confluence)
Benefits
- International projects with top brands
- Work with global teams of highly skilled, diverse peers
- Healthcare benefits
- Employee financial programs
- Paid time off and sick leave
- Upskilling, reskilling and certification courses
- Unlimited access to the LinkedIn Learning library and 22,000+ courses
- Global career opportunities
- Volunteer and community involvement opportunities
- EPAM Employee Groups
- Award-winning culture recognized by Glassdoor, Newsweek and LinkedIn